Painting Description
Bewegungsstudien, translated as "Studies of Movement," is a notable work by the German painter Lovis Corinth (1858–1925), who is widely recognized for his contributions to the German Impressionist and Expressionist movements. Corinth's oeuvre is characterized by a vigorous and dynamic style, and Bewegungsstudien exemplifies his fascination with capturing the fluidity and vitality of human motion.
Created during a period when Corinth was deeply engaged in exploring the human form, Bewegungsstudien reflects his academic training and his innovative approach to depicting movement. The work is part of a broader series of studies where Corinth meticulously observed and rendered the subtleties of physical gestures and postures. This series is significant as it showcases Corinth's transition from a more traditional, academic style to a freer, more expressive technique that would later define his mature works.
Bewegungsstudien is particularly important in the context of Corinth's artistic development. It demonstrates his keen interest in the anatomical accuracy and the expressive potential of the human body. Through these studies, Corinth sought to convey not just the physicality but also the emotional and psychological states of his subjects. His brushwork in these studies is often vigorous and spontaneous, capturing the essence of movement with a sense of immediacy and energy.
The work also reflects the broader artistic trends of the late 19th and early 20th centuries, where there was a growing interest in the dynamics of movement, influenced by advancements in photography and the study of human kinetics. Corinth's Bewegungsstudien can be seen as part of this larger cultural and artistic exploration, bridging the gap between traditional figure studies and modernist expressions of form and motion.
Overall, Bewegungsstudien by Lovis Corinth is a testament to the artist's skill and his innovative spirit. It remains a significant piece within his body of work, illustrating his mastery in capturing the essence of movement and his contribution to the evolution of modern art.
